Story:

Srimannarayana is a 2012 Telugu-language action movie that was directed by Ravi Chavali, filmed by T. Surendra Reddy, and produced by Ramesh Puppala under the Yellow Flowers banner. starring Isha Chawla, Parvati Melton, and Nandamuri Balakrishna; music by Chakri.

The film opens with three resentful characters conducting land encroachment: Agricultural Minister Bail Reddy, his brother-in-law Pulikeshava Reddy, and well-known Malaysian Hawala trader Harshad Kotari. The government, police, and judiciary are defeated by the Jai Jawan Scam, which squats the schemes assigned to disable soldiers. Here, a lone supporter who comes to their assistance is the fearless and combative journalist Srimannarayana, who exposes the middleman and grants the original land. Simultaneously, the reporter Swapnika is his opponent, attempting in vain to overcome him as white on rice. She develops feelings for him after a string of mishaps, but Srimannarayana is already engaged to his cousin Bhanumati. She persists, though, and the two engage in competition.

In addition, Padma Shri recipient Kalki Narayana Murthy, the father of Srimannarayana, is a social activist. At that time, Dr. Srikar Prasad, Premier Bank Chairman Rajan Mudaliar, and three more evil IG Marthands come. As a result, Narayana Murthy wants to create the Jai Kisan Trust, an organisation that will provide enormous financial results of ₹5,000,000,000 (US$63 million) for farmer welfare. As soon as the money is ready to be used, it is transferred to Premier Bank; remarkably, Narayana Murthy passes away under suspicious circumstances, and 63 million is embezzled. Srimannarayana is implicated in the swindle, distracted, and depraved at the same time.

He is now being held, and Gyaneshwar of the CBI is in charge of the case. But when Srimannarayana notices a bell ringing at Rajan Mudaliar, he begins his investigation there, assisted by Swapnika. As a result, he coerces Jailor Shankar Reddy to breach the bars without being heard. As of right now, Rajan Mudaliar reveals the truth: these six knaves murdered Narayana Murthy in cold blood while pretending to have a heart attack. Additionally, the funds are transferred to a Swiss bank, where each person knows the six-letter password. Therefore, enraged Srimannarayana begins his murderous rampage by eliminating all five of the blackguards without leaving any trace and obtaining their passwords, which are 4, K, I, A, and N.

Gyaneshwar makes every effort to strike him, but it never succeeds. Concurrently, he manages to exonerate himself and establish his innocence. Harshad kidnaps Srimannarayana’s family today, puts them in danger, and demands the password. At that moment, he deftly realises that S is his hidden letter between I&A. Remarkably, Srimannarayana states that 4KISAN is the lock that was unintentionally made by the harsh. Finally, Harshad is defeated by Srimannarayana after Gyaneshwar closes the case because there is no testament. Ultimately, with Srimannarayana outsetting Jai Kisan Trust, the film closes on a positive note.
